Borussia M'gladbach vs Mainz soccer prediction, stats and h2h

07.03.2025
BORUSSIA-PARK
2.60
3.30
2.70

Live game details

Borussia M'gladbach Mainz
39’ goal P. Nebel
49’ goal D. Kohr
56’ subst A. Plea for K. Stoger
64’ subst A. Hanche-Olsen for D. da Costa
70’ subst N. Weiper for J. Burkardt
73’ goal S. Lainer
74’ subst L. Netz for L. Ullrich
74’ subst F. Neuhaus for R. Hack
74’ subst S. Fukuda for P. Sander
77’ goal N. Amiri
85’ subst N. Pesch for N. Ngoumou
87’ subst S. Widmer for A. Caci
87’ subst A. Sieb for Lee Jae-Sung
87’ subst L. Maloney for N. Amiri
90’ yellowcard K. Sano

Compare teams

Borussia M'gladbach Mainz
Won 5 in last 10 gamesWon 4 in last 10 games
Not won 5 in last 10 gamesNot won 6 in last 10 games
Lost 3 in last 10 gamesLost 3 in last 10 games
Draw 2 in last 10 gamesDraw 3 in last 10 games
Last five games
LDWWL
LDLDW
Last 5 home/away only
LWLLD
LLWWW

Predictions

3 on Draw

Over 2.5 goals

Score Tip - 2:2

Game Stats Game Odds

Head to Head matches

  • 25.10.24 FT
    FSV Mainz 05
    Borussia Mönchengladbach
    1
    1
  • 02.03.24 FT
    FSV Mainz 05
    Borussia Monchengladbach
    1
    1
  • 06.10.23 FT
    Borussia Monchengladbach
    FSV Mainz 05
    2
    2
  • 24.02.23 FT
    FSV Mainz 05
    Borussia Monchengladbach
    4
    0
  • 04.09.22 FT
    Borussia Monchengladbach
    FSV Mainz 05
    0
    1

Latest games stats

Borussia M'gladbach Mainz
Over 1.5
90%80%
Over 2.5
70%40%
Over 3.5
20%30%
Average Scored
1.601.30
Average Conceded
1.401.10

Power rank last games

Power rank - Team strength (goals, victories, possession, corners, attacking pressure and defense performance).
Team W D L GOALS O2.5 BTTS POWER
Borussia M'gladbach
5
2
3
16:14
70%
70%
109.5
Mainz
4
3
3
13:11
40%
50%
100.9

Borussia M'gladbach (home only) team power rank.

Team W D L GOALS O2.5 BTTS POWER
Borussia M'gladbach
3
3
4
14:14
60%
60%
89.9

Mainz (away only) team power rank.

Team W D L GOALS O2.5 BTTS POWER
Mainz
4
0
6
15:16
60%
60%
89.0

Borussia M'gladbach last results

  • 12.04 FT
    Borussia Mönchengladbach
    SC Freiburg
    L
    1
    2
  • 06.04 FT
    FC St. Pauli
    Borussia Mönchengladbach
    D
    1
    1
  • 29.03 FT
    Borussia Mönchengladbach
    RB Leipzig
    W
    1
    0
  • 15.03 FT
    Werder Bremen
    Borussia Mönchengladbach
    W
    2
    4
  • 07.03 FT
    Borussia Mönchengladbach
    FSV Mainz 05
    L
    1
    3
  • 01.03 FT
    1. FC Heidenheim
    Borussia Mönchengladbach
    W
    0
    3
  • 22.02 FT
    Borussia Mönchengladbach
    FC Augsburg
    L
    0
    3
  • 15.02 FT
    Union Berlin
    Borussia Mönchengladbach
    W
    1
    2
  • 08.02 FT
    Borussia Mönchengladbach
    Eintracht Frankfurt
    D
    1
    1
  • 01.02 FT
    VfB Stuttgart
    Borussia Mönchengladbach
    W
    1
    2

Mainz last results

  • 12.04 FT
    1899 Hoffenheim
    FSV Mainz 05
    L
    2
    0
  • 05.04 FT
    FSV Mainz 05
    Holstein Kiel
    D
    1
    1
  • 30.03 FT
    Borussia Dortmund
    FSV Mainz 05
    L
    3
    1
  • 15.03 FT
    FSV Mainz 05
    SC Freiburg
    D
    2
    2
  • 07.03 FT
    Borussia Mönchengladbach
    FSV Mainz 05
    W
    1
    3
  • 01.03 FT
    RB Leipzig
    FSV Mainz 05
    W
    1
    2
  • 22.02 FT
    FSV Mainz 05
    FC St. Pauli
    W
    2
    0
  • 16.02 FT
    1. FC Heidenheim
    FSV Mainz 05
    W
    0
    2
  • 08.02 FT
    FSV Mainz 05
    FC Augsburg
    D
    0
    0
  • 31.01 FT
    Werder Bremen
    FSV Mainz 05
    L
    1
    0

Related Predictions

Tables

Overall Standings

Team G W D L G P
1 Bayern München
29
21
6
2
83:29
69
2 Bayer Leverkusen
29
18
9
2
63:34
63
3 Eintracht Frankfurt
29
15
6
8
58:42
51
4 RB Leipzig
29
13
9
7
47:37
48
5 FSV Mainz 05
29
13
7
9
46:34
46
6 SC Freiburg
29
13
6
10
40:45
45
7 Borussia Mönchengladbach
29
13
5
11
46:43
44
8 Borussia Dortmund
29
12
6
11
54:45
42
9 Werder Bremen
29
12
6
11
47:54
42
10 FC Augsburg
29
11
9
9
33:40
42
11 VfB Stuttgart
29
11
7
11
52:46
40
12 VfL Wolfsburg
29
10
8
11
51:45
38
13 Union Berlin
29
9
7
13
26:40
34
14 1899 Hoffenheim
29
7
9
13
36:52
30
15 FC St. Pauli
29
8
5
16
25:35
29
16 1. FC Heidenheim
29
6
4
19
32:56
22
17 VfL Bochum
29
5
5
19
29:61
20
18 Holstein Kiel
29
4
6
19
40:70
18
Promotion - Champions League (League phase)
Promotion - Europa League (League phase)
Promotion - Conference League (Qualification)
Bundesliga (Relegation)
Relegation - 2. Bundesliga